Expand and simplify: 3(x-y)+4(x+2y)
Respuesta :
122317
122317
09-11-2017
Expanded form: 3x - 3y + 4x + 8y Simplified form: 7x + 5y. In order to do this, you need to distribute. After that, you combine your like terms.
